Driver Shift Control (DSC)

Driver Shift Control (DSC) allows you to shift an automatic transmission similar to a manual transmission. To use the DSC feature:

1. Move the shift lever to the left from D (Drive) to M (Manual Mode).
2. To enter M(Manual Mode), press the shift lever forward (+) to upshift or rearward (−) to downshift.
